Subject: Re: Debian and win95
I think this works:
Have a debian boot floppy - the ususal backup.
Install W95, destroying what lilo has written in the mbr.
Boot with the floppy to start linux; then run lilo.
This assumes that /etc/lilo.conf is proper and that your boot disk is ok,
of course. Check them first.
